Frequently Asked Questions

  • Q: What are the gauges of these guitar strings? A: The gauges are eleven, fifteen, twenty-two wound, thirty, forty-two, and fifty-two. These provide a light feel while maintaining rich tone.
  • Q: What materials are used in the strings? A: The strings are made with ninety-two percent copper, seven point seven percent tin, and zero point five percent phosphorus. They are wound around a brass-plated hex-shaped steel core.
  • Q: What is the packaging of the strings like? A: The strings come in Element Shield Packaging. This helps prolong string life and keeps them fresh.
